My Silver Wing has the Givi E55 and Airflow screen, I bought the Oxford Products cover size Large and it fitted well. It allowed me to push an Abus chain through slots in the cover to secure the front wheel and has a Fastex buckled strap that goes under the Silver Wing to stop any gusts of wind getting in.
